Operating costs<br />
<strong>Energy</strong> efficiency / heat loss<br />
• Built-in diffusion barrier<br />
– Prevents ageing of insulation<br />
– Reduces energy losses<br />
22/05/2013<br />
Cyclopentane, λ = 0.012 W/mK<br />
CO2, λ = 0.017 W/mK<br />
Nitrogen<br />
Oxygen<br />
λ air= 0.027 W/mK<br />
Lambda (λ) expresses the insulation property of a material.<br />
The lower the lambda value, the better the insulation.<br />
Result:<br />
• Lower operating costs<br />
• Less environmental impact<br />

Operating costs<br />
<strong>LOGSTOR</strong> fusion welded joints<br />
• They are made of the same material<br />
as the outer casing<br />
• The PE-weld between the outer<br />
casing and the joint is computercontrolled<br />
resulting in an optimum<br />
welding process<br />
• The joint and the outer casing melt<br />
together to a solid, unbreakable unit<br />
22/05/2013<br />
• As the weld process is controlled by a<br />
computer, human errors during<br />
installation are eliminated<br />
• The joint is designed to withstand all<br />
impacts, it is exposed to during the<br />
entire service life of the pipe system<br />

Operating costs<br />
SXJoint<br />
• The SXJoint is made of cross linked polyethylene (PEX)<br />
• The unique molecular structure of cross linked polyethylene means that<br />
its properties include an exceptionally strong shrinkability which keeps<br />
the casing joint tight and in place<br />
• The casing joint is designed to withstand all impacts which it is exposed<br />
to during the entire service life of the pipe system.<br />
